Gasquet advances to Mercedes semis

Published: July 11, 2008 at 3:26 PM

STUTTGART, Germany, July 11 (UPI) -- Twenty-two-year-old Richard Gasquet of France, the No. 2 seed, won in straight sets Friday to reach the semifinals of the Mercedes Cup at Stuttgart, Germany.

Gasquet battled to a 6-3, 7-6 (7-5) victory over Albert Montanes of Spain to make it into the semifinal round for the first time this year.

Argentine Juan Martin Del Potro eliminated German Philipp Kohschreiber 7-6 (7-3) 6-3 in another quarterfinal match.

Gasquet takes on Agustin Calleri of Argentina, who ousted German Michael Berrer 6-4, 6-2, in the semis Saturday.

In the other bracket, Del Potro goes against countryman Eduardo Schwank, who topped Czech Jan Hernych 6-0, 4-6, 6-3.
